100+ Places to Post and Share Your Photos Online

By Laura Milligan

Personalizing your own Web space to show the world snapshots of your lifestyle has become ever more popular thanks to digital cameras and the increasing number of social networking sites, online photo albums and blogs. Stuffing a dusty photo album with the pictures from your last vacation or family blowout will no longer do. Your adventures deserve a broader audience than the lucky few who drop by your house, and the Internet is the perfect place to showcase your life. Read below for our list of over 100 places to post and share your photos online.

Most Popular

The following sites feature some of the most sought after photo sharing programs online.

  1. MyPhotoAlbum.com: This website offers users features that will help you create “online photo albums as unique as you are.” Once you’ve uploaded your photos, turn them into cards, e-mails invitations and more.
  2. Snapfish: Store and share your photos online for free when you use Snapfish, a company that also lets you create novelty items like mugs and other gifts.
  3. Kodak Gallery: Invite friends and family to browse through your uploaded photos on this site, leaving comments and listening to an audio slideshow as they click through your albums.
  4. Picasa: Google sponsors this Web-based photo album program, which allows users to post and share their own photos as well as “view and save…friends’ photos.”
  5. Photobucket: This popular site features free photo and video sharing and image hosting.
  6. Shutterfly: This free online photo sharing system lets you, as well as friends and family, order prints and create calendars from the photos you upload.
  7. AlbumPost: The motto for this purist site is “No ads. Just your pictures.” Sign up for a 10-day free trial.
  8. PhotoBox: Keep your albums private, or allow them to be seen by public viewers. PhotoBox also lets users create posters and calendars from their photos.
  9. PixyShare: Check out this basic online photo album to share pictures with family and friends.
  10. Fotopic: Receive your own Web address when you create a photo album with Fotopic.
  11. Album Town: Album Town features free online photo sharing and allows users to create an unlimited number of albums.
  12. PixMatrix: This “free photo album software “helps users design personalized photo albums to share and store digital images online.”
  13. Hello: Say hello with a photograph. With this program, “you get to see your photographs together with your friends online” without having to bother with attachments or slow loading times.
  14. Webshots: This immensely popular site sponsors “photo sharing, free wallpaper and free screensavers.” Sign up for free to start sharing your images with family and friends.

Networking Sites

These sites feature add-ons and accessories for photo hosting sites like Facebook and support their own networking communities for photo lovers.

  1. Fotop: Create an online photo blog using the features provided by fotop. Members also connect with other photographers to form a “fast growing online photo sharing community.”
  2. Photo Chart: Vote on other users’ photos and albums or create your own network to share images and connect with photographers around the world.
  3. BytePhoto: Become a member of the BytePhoto community to set up a free online photo album, submit images for regular contests and get feedback from other photographers about your work.
  4. Rock You: Rock You works in conjunction with popular networking sites like Facebook and MySpace to create custom designed photo slideshows of your uploaded digital images.
  5. Ovao: Join this network to post your photos and videos online for everyone to see.
  6. Amiglia: This family tree-plus-photo album site connects families through its networking and photo sharing capabilities.
  7. Mashable: Submit your photos to the social networking news site Mashable, and see if they end up in the top ranked, most viewed, or most discussed categories.
  8. Zooomr: Zooomr is “universally the best way to share, search, store, sort and sell your photos online.” Members from all over connect to form an international photography community.
  9. ImageShack: Create an account with ImageShack to create an album or manage photos on Facebook.
  10. Tabblo: This community-based photo sharing and management site offers “rich content-creation tools for both online and print.” Set up an online album, or design personalized products inspired by your favorite images.
  11. Twango: Twango is a “free and fun place to share your photos, videos and audio.” Join the other members to discuss and rate submissions, leave comments and more.
  12. Photo.net: Photo.net is a website devoted to all things photography. Post your photos to find out what others think of your artistic style, or have fun rating other members’ images.

Privacy Features

If you want top-notch security protection when you post your photos on the Web, try using one of these programs to keep your images private.

  1. SmugMug: Post your photos onto this site, and you’ll be looking at your life in a whole new light. High quality images and a promise for “safe and secure” membership make SmugMug a top site.
  2. RitzPix: Only you get to decide which people can view the photos you upload on RitzPix.
  3. PhotoZig: PhotoZig allows you to easily access and control your digital images online with photo albums, slideshow software and other helpful tools.
  4. KoffeePhoto: Try out this free photo sharing program that comes with an ultra secure backup system to keep your pictures safe.
  5. Pickle: This fun site comes with strict privacy settings that let users control who they want to view their photos and videos.
  6. PixVillage: Known as “the Kazaa of photography,” PixVillage is an online photo sharing system that provides secure privacy features to its members.
  7. PhotoApe: Sign up with PhotoApe to receive your own URL and start sharing photos with family and friends via a secure login system.
  8. Thumbnail Cafe: Thumbnail Cafe offers “a smarter way to organize and share your photos.” Start a free trial subscription to try out the excellent security features.
  9. KeepandShare: This Web-based file sharing community also supports private photo sharing capabilities within private group websites.
  10. Photagious: This inexpensive photo sharing software program has a backup system, member privacy features and beautiful Flash slideshows.
  11. EnjoyMyMedia: This system is a “safe, simple” option for the “free sharing of personal media,” including photos.
  12. Crypto Heaven: Crypto Heaven supports secure e-mail, chat services, online storage and file sharing systems for your most private documents and photos.

Travel

Adventure junkies will love the photo sharing culture of the following websites, where members upload images and swap stories about all things travel.

  1. Ball of Dirt: This network of travel blogs and online photo albums “lets anyone share their travel photos, stories and experiences on the web for free.”
  2. Travel Photo Sharing: This online photo sharing gallery caters to the world traveler. Browse albums from Russia, Taiwan, or Brazil, or create one of your own.
  3. Worldisround: Worldisround is a “global community for sharing photos and exploring the world.” Currently boasting more than 650,000 images from around the world, this site also features travel-related articles.
  4. Your Shot Photo Sharing: The “Your Shot” feature on the Travel Channel’s website allows everyday travelers to send in their favorite images from adventures around the world.
  5. Cruise Reviews Photo Sharing: The popular Cruise Reviews website also hosts travel photo albums for travelers to upload their digital images from cruise vacations.
  6. PhotoTraces: Experienced travel photographers can write articles for the blogs on PhotoTraces.com, “an effective promotional tool for photographers publishing articles” and who wish to gain more exposure.
  7. FotoTrekn: FotoTrekn is “where great photo treks begin.” Upload your travel pictures, browse public and members only galleries, meet up with other travelers on the forums, or start blogging about your trip on this terrific site.
  8. TravelBlog: TravelBlog members send in photos from their trips all over the globe. Check out the featured photos, which change every 30 minutes, or set up your own album through your travel journal.
  9. Travelpod: Travelpod is another online travelogue that lets travelers post blog entries and share photos with family, friends, and other adventurers.
  10. BootsnAll: This international travelers’ community hosts forums that frequently advertise photography contests, discussions and image sharing.
  11. TravBuddy: This social community made up of enthusiastic travelers lets users share photos, reviews, experiences, blog entries and more.
